Over the past 10 years, there have been 3 property sales recorded in the NW3 1EL postcode area. The highest sale price reached £10,500,000, while the most recent sale was for a semi-detached house sold in October 2023 for £10,500,000.
The estimated average property value in NW3 1EL currently stands at £5,806,890, which is approximately 563.4% higher than the city average, indicating a potentially more desirable or in-demand location.
In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£22,298.
Property prices in NW3 1EL have risen by 1.4% over the past year , with a total increase of 12.2% over the past five years, and a long-term rise of 22.7% over the past decade.
The most common type of property sold in the area is detached, making up around 67% of transactions , followed by semi-detached.
Housing in NW3 1EL is predominantly owner-occupied, with an estimated 66% of homes being lived in by the owners.
Properties at NW3 1EL appear three times in the Land Registry records, with the latest transaction recorded on 6 Oct 2023. It also has three Energy Performance Certificates (EPC) entries, the earliest dating back to 26 Oct 2016. We use this data, to estimate the property's characteristics and current market value.
